Introduction to Python and its relevance in seismic data processing

In this lesson, we will discuss the importance of Python in seismic data processing. Python is a powerful programming language that is widely used in the field of geophysics due to its versatility and ease of use. It allows geoscientists to efficiently analyze and visualize large volumes of seismic data, making complex tasks easier to handle.

We will explore how Python can be used in conjunction with tools like Geomage to enhance seismic data processing workflows. By leveraging Python's libraries and modules, we can automate repetitive tasks, build custom algorithms, and create interactive applications for seismic data analysis. This will ultimately lead to faster and more accurate results in seismic interpretation and reservoir characterization.
